Reporting to the Director of Nursing, the incumbent will teach discipline-specific courses as needed using a variety of methodologies. Responsibilities will include course preparation and instruction; curriculum development; participation in the college community and continued professional growth activities, and creative program building based on needs assessment and collaboration with other faculty. May be asked to teach other courses in disciplines in which she/he is able to be credentialed.
Besides traditional class structuring, the College is also attempting to meet the varying needs of our students by offering weekend, year-round, and compressed courses of instruction and services. Since service to our students is our highest priority, instructors can expect to participate in innovative methods and assignments may be multi-campus and/or at clinical agency locations with the possibility of interactive, online, day, evening, and/or weekend classes. In addition to a competitive salary and relocation for these 9-month positions, we offer generous time off (including a two-week
winter break and a one-week spring break, 10 sick days annually, up to 3 personal days (from the sick leave bank), retirement, medical/dental/vision insurance, life insurance at 2 x basic salary and more.

The Brown Mindfulness Center is conducting a research study to test if a short mindfulness-based training is effective at reducing burnout in nurses. Participants must be nurses. If you are a nurse and you are interested in helping us to learn about burnout, please contact Brown affiliated contact person at burnout-research@brown.edu. Use of this message for recruiting participants has been approved by Brown's Human Research Protection Program. Protocol # 2022003296.
